Mastering its Art of Organic Soil: Secrets for Thriving Gardens
Unlock the potential of organic soil and cultivate gardens that burst with life! Nurturing healthy soil is a foundation for abundant plants. By embracing natural methods, you can build a living ecosystem that sustains your flowers. A rich, organic soil is alive with beneficial microbes and organisms that unlock read more essential nutrients for your plants to prosper.
- Compost: The heart of any thriving organic garden. Add compost regularly to enrich soil structure and fertility.
- Earthworm Tea: These organic fertilizers supply a concentrated dose of nutrients that plants love.
- Cover Crops: Plant soil blankets to protect your soil between plantings. They add vital organic matter and combat weeds.
Manage irrigation by using mulch to retain soil moisture and decrease evaporation.
